Keys Creek Lavender Farm is in bloom!
What a beautiful sight it is at Keys Creek Lavender Farm in Valley Center! If you are looking for something fun to do with your family in San Diego, take a trip to the Lavendar Farms. They are open daily from 10-3 and even have tours. Refer to their website https://keyscreeklavenderfarm.com/ for the details.

I purchased some of their lavender lotion for my mom on Mother’s day, she loved it! They have tons of hand crafted goodies made from their lavender. If you like Pinterest this just might be a little overwhelming, because their shop has tons of cool things you would have never thought of.
They also host private events and I cant wait for a call to do a wedding at the Lavendar Farms. The best time of year is now (May-June) because that is when the lavender is blooming.
